replacing my jd870
i am looking at trading my trusty old jd870. went and looked at a Kubota l3800 but can't seem to find a comparable jd model for the same price. requirements include aprox. 30hp and 60" 0r less width. any advice would be appreciated

Re: replacing my jd870
The deere equivalent would be the 3320.
As far as prices...can't help. Prices do tend to be regoinal though...Roy Jackson
